Seek medical attention
If you are involved in a truck accident it is imperative to seek medical attention. The best place to seek treatment is at an urgent-care or emergency facility. This will ensure that any injuries are dealt with immediately and that you receive appropriate care.
Getting a thorough examination from an expert in medical care will help you understand the extent of your injuries and how long it will take to recover. This will also provide you with important evidence to support your claim.
Injuries such as whiplash, concussions or traumatic brain injury (TBI) internal bleeding and organ damage can't be diagnosed by your doctor. You will require the expertise of a qualified doctor to determine the cause of them. These injuries might not be apparent for days or even weeks following an accident. They could cause serious truck accident lawyer harm if left untreated.
You should visit a doctor as soon as possible after an accident regardless of whether you feel any pain. Headaches and nausea, fatigue dizziness, slurred speech and slurred words can be signs of more serious health issues that you thought.
Certain injuries, such as an injury to the back or neck, may not cause pain until few days after the accident. This is due to the body's normal injury response, which produces huge amounts of hormones which diminish the sensation of pain.
Additionally, head injuries could not be apparent immediately since the symptoms may develop weeks or even months after the accident. These injuries can be very dangerous and can cause life-altering issues or even death if they are not treated promptly.
If you delay waiting too long to see a doctor, your insurance company could deny or offer a settlement which will not be enough to cover your expenses. This could drastically reduce the amount of money you are entitled to during your trial.
Documenting your medical treatment is equally important. This includes any diagnostic tests that you've had, medications that you take in addition to your notes on your health. This will aid you and your lawyer to prove the severity of your injuries.

Don't accept a settlement
There is no reason to accept a settlement offer from an insurance company you feel does not cover the full amount of your damages. A reasonable settlement will be one that is sufficient to pay for your current and future medical expenses, lost wages, and other expenses. However, it's difficult to determine how much you will need in the future to cover all of these things.
Your lawyer can help decide whether a settlement is the best option for you. They will explain to you your legal rights under New York Law and the insurance coverage that is available under your policy. This information will allow them to negotiate with the insurance company to negotiate a reasonable settlement for you.
If they choose to accept an offer for settlement they will inform you about it and offer you the opportunity to review it. They will then ask whether you are at ease and if you have some room for negotiation.
You don't have to agree to the offer and can formally oppose it by writing an email to the insurance company, stating that you do not accept the conditions of their offer. You can counteroffer a higher settlement amount based upon your damages and injuries.
Even if the insurance company tries to entice you into accepting an unfair settlement, you should refuse to accept any settlement that you do not believe fair. Even the smallest differences in legal or factual information can have a dramatic impact on the amount of damages you're entitled to, particularly when it comes to truck accidents.
Another factor to consider is how the accident will impact your future job opportunities as well as your the level of activity and mobility and overall health. Your lawyer will discuss everything with you and will also discuss any ongoing treatment or care that you might require because of the accident.
If your lawyer decides that the settlement is unfair, they'll discuss the pros and cons with you of filing a lawsuit and taking the case to court. They will also be able to answer your questions about how much it would cost and whether or not they feel that you will be successful in court.
